Paris Saint-Germain manager, Luis Enrique, has confirmed that defender Nuno Mendes could return for their Champions League second leg against Real Sociedad.

The Ligue 1 champions won the first leg 2-0, thanks to goals from Kylian Mbappe and Bradley Barcola.

Enrique’s side now needs to avoid defeat in Spain to book their spot in the quarter-final and he could have Mendes available.

“He could start tomorrow, but won’t play the whole game.

“He is a top-class player, it’s fantastic to have Nuno back — he’s great both offensively and defensively,” Enrique said.
